Possible Causes of Appliance Leaks
Kitchen and laundry appliances, such as dishwashers, washing machines, and refrigerators, are common sources of water leaks in homes. Over time, worn-out hoses, damaged seals, or faulty valves can cause these appliances to leak water unexpectedly. Sometimes, even minor cracks or corrosion in the appliance’s interior parts can lead to significant water seepage.
Additionally, improper installation or maintenance issues can contribute to appliance leaks. If these devices are not installed correctly or if hoses and connections are not checked regularly, small drips can turn into larger water problems. Environmental factors like high humidity or temperature fluctuations can also weaken components, increasing the risk of leaks.
How Our Experts Handle Appliance Leak Cleanup
When you contact us for appliance leak cleanup, our team responds quickly to assess the situation. We begin by locating the source of the leak and evaluating the extent of water damage. Our technicians are trained to identify hidden moisture areas that might not be immediately visible.
Once the origin of the leak is identified, we shut off the appliance and stop any further water flow to prevent additional damage. We then remove standing water and use advanced drying equipment to thoroughly dry the affected areas. Our team also inspects the surrounding structures, including flooring and cabinetry, to ensure there is no hidden water lingering that could cause mold growth or structural issues.
To ensure total restoration, we perform thorough cleaning and disinfection of the affected spaces. How do you prevent mold growth after a leak?
Thorough drying and moisture removal are key to preventing mold. Our team uses powerful air movers and dehumidifiers to eliminate excess humidity. We also perform mold prevention treatments if necessary to ensure your home remains safe and healthy.
